Riverside Renaissance making Tequesquite Park a reality
Plans for the long-awaited Tequesquite Park are
underway. On July 27 the City Council
appropriated funds for the development of construction
drawings for the park on July 27.
This future park will be located on 43-acres near the
base of Mount Rubidoux just
north of the Wood Streets neighborhood.

Metropolitan Museum improvements
The Riverside Metropolitan Museum is set to receive some
much needed repairs
to its downtown facility. The City Council recently
voted to seek bids for an
estimated $2 million in projects to repair the roof,
make the building safer during
earthquakes, construct ADA improvements and related
items.

SmartRiverside Charity Golf Tournament
SmartRiverside will be holding their annual Golf Charity
on October 11 at
the Victoria Club. SmartRiverside is providing
assistance to the Lorena Ochoa
Foundation who has provided signed memorabilia for the
event as the world’s
top female golfer for the past 5 years. All proceeds
benefit digital inclusion which
provides free training, PCs and WiFi internet to
low-income Riverside families.
